The solar heating tubes are a unique approach to raising the temperature of water used throughout your home. A closed system, it makes use of vacuum sealed tubes containing narrow metal blades. As sunlight hits these blades, they heat water in tubes running through the middle of the blades. This water circulates back to your current systems through coils and radiates heat into the usable water in your tank. The water in the solar heating tubes is not the water that you drink; rather, this water travels through coils that bring the heat energy to the water that you bathe with.

Solar heating tubes, such as those in the green energy systems in Commack, work in both the summer and winter - based on sunlight. These break resistant glass tubes house the blades in a sealed environment. The ambient temperature has no effect on the blade. Even in the cold of winter, solar heating tubes collect sunlight and create heat that heats the water passing through the central tube, as high as 190F. The Government runs the Energy Star program, now touting more than 1 million Energy Star rated houses. To achieve these Energy Star Guidelines, set by the EPA, homes must be at least 15% more energy efficient than houses built to the 2004 international residential code, and are often 20 to 30% more efficient than standard houses.

To earn the Energy Star certification, the homes must include a variety of "tried-and-true" energy-efficient factors that contribute to the total efficiency of your house. These features make your home more comfortable, lower their energy demand and reduce the amount of air pollution created.

Efficient Heating and Cooling Equipment

This is one of the biggest factors in keeping your house very efficient. Old heating systems and air conditioners often waste a massive amount of energy. They consume more power than needed to produce the desired results and, if they are not run efficiently, they need to be run for longer periods of time (burning additional energy). More energy efficient systems are better able to stabilize your house, requiring reduced system usage.

Effective Insulation

Why heat your house if it simply leaks to the outside? A well insulated home, including attics, floors and walls help you keep even temperatures throughout the year. As you preserve a constant temperature in your home, your heating and cooling equipment will turn on less often, consuming less power.

High-Performance Windows

Windows with UV coating,Newer windows with UV protection and good seals to prevent drafts, can lower your energy bills and lower their total cost of ownership.

Tight Construction and Docs

Energy Star rated homes need tight construction and air tight duct work. Cracks and holes in the home allow heat to escape in the cold months and heat to enter in the hot months. This places additional strain on your climate systems, wasting electricity. Leaks also trigger bigger fluctuations in the temperature of your house, requiring systems to turn on and off more often. Drafts, which frustrate many homeowners, are caused by such duct leaks, cracks and holes in the home.

Energy-Efficient Products

By purchasing energy efficient products and appliances, ranging from light fixtures and light bulbs to ventilation fans and kitchen appliances, you are able to reduce your electric demand while still getting the services you need.

Third-Party Verification

Independent house energy assessors are able to review the houses and certify them as Energy Star rated. They evaluate the house, through an inspection process that to certify air tightness, insulation, the ceiling structure, components used, appliances and more.

Which Hot Water Heating System is the Most Practical?

By Evan Roberts

Everyone wants hot water in their homes, and many homeowners are forced to look into hot water heating systems as a means of ensuring the optimal temperature for their showers and other activities.

Let's take a look at a few of the different types of options available on the market. Hopefully one of these will appeal to you more than others, leading to a successful purchase that satisfies your needs.

Any discussion of hot water heating systems should begin with gas, since these are the most popular option in homes. Since they require the smallest investment with respect to buying one, people usually opt for these.

The advantage is the relatively small outlay as compared to other means, though there are a few disadvantages involved with these units too. Not only is it somewhat dangerous to have a device in your house that depends on gas, but the cost of replacing gas can add up over time.

Many people like the convenience offered by an electrical model. These are pretty easy to install, and owners don't need to worry about buying gas refills to keep them going. On the other hand, one's electric bill can be pretty high after leaving these running all the time.

Perhaps the lowest maintenance device is the solar hot water heating system, though it's also the most expensive. Since the energy cost here is nonexistent, this is a great option for those who can afford the cost. These solar devices continue to grow in popularity.

For those looking to save on energy bills but without the budget to pay for a solar model, the on demand hot water heater might be a nice compromise. These only operate upon your request, though the water can take a bit longer to heat up. Large families with a constant need for hot water may struggle to do well with these, since a larger water tank will generally take even longer before it heats up.

The choice is yours when all is said and done. Consider your needs, and weigh out the importance of up front expenses, monthly energy costs, and ease of use. - 31812

A solar oven or solar cooker is a device which uses sunlight as its energy source. Because they use no fuel and they cost nothing to run, humanitarian organizations are promoting their use worldwide to help slow deforestation and desertification , caused by using wood as fuel for cooking. The most important thing to consider when using a solar cooker is that this is a long process and should be used to cook something that can safely cook at low temperatures for most of the day. The only disadvantage of the solar cooker is that it depends on regular sunshine. It can be used in countries which experience a dry sunny climate for al least six months a year.
